๐ฏ The Quick Answer: Adding an "es" to "Dress"
Letโs start with the basics! In English, the plural of "dress" is "dresses." Yes, itโs that easy โ just add an "es" at the end. ๐ But why does it work this way? Well, most nouns ending in "s," "x," "z," "ch," or "sh" follow this rule by adding "es" to make them plural. For example, "box" becomes "boxes," and "buzz" turns into "buzzes." ๐ Beyond Grammar: Why Dresses Are Fashion Icons
Dresses arenโt just words; theyโre cultural symbols! Think about it โ from Little Red Riding Hoodโs charming frock ๐ to Audrey Hepburnโs iconic Givenchy gown โจ, dresses have shaped history. And letโs not forget the power of a LBD (Little Black Dress)! Whether itโs a cocktail dress for date night ๐ฅ or a sundress for summer vibes โ๏ธ, dresses are as diverse as the women who wear them. Fun fact: Did you know the word "dress" comes from Old French "drescer," meaning "to prepare"? It makes sense because dressing up is all about preparation and confidence! ๐
๐ฎ The Future of Dresses: Trends Shaping Tomorrow
So, whatโs next for dresses? With sustainability being a hot topic in 2023, eco-friendly materials like Tencel and recycled polyester are gaining traction. ๐ฑ Plus, inclusivity is redefining fashion norms, with brands offering extended sizes and adaptive designs.
